Output ec64597e630095e5021cf69f225f32907198f1262be64ccbe9b7822edc689ec0:0

value
87507
script pubkey
OP_0 OP_PUSHBYTES_32 859550161789d9150b1793711f964ce4d0acda93bc4043b1a0431a2ef24d4aab
address
bc1qsk24q9sh38v32zchjdc3l9jvung2ek5nh3qy8vdqgvdzaujdf24sftrv9u
transaction
ec64597e630095e5021cf69f225f32907198f1262be64ccbe9b7822edc689ec0